At its April 14 meeting, the Commission introduced an ordinance to define and regulate smoke shops. The Planning Board reviewed the ordinance at its April 21 meeting and recommended several changes. These changes are currently under review by Allegheny County, as required by the Pennsylvania Municipalities Planning Code. Therefore, the Commission will not be holding the previously announced public hearing on this ordinance at the May 14 meeting. The Commission will set a new date for a public hearing after the Planning Board makes a recommendation on the ordinance. The Planning Board is scheduled to discuss the ordinance at its June 16 meeting.
